Subject: [PATCH 4/7] shippable.yml: Remove the Debian9-based MinGW cross-compiler tests
Date: Mon, 21 Sep 2020 19:43:17 +0200 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20200921174320.46062-5-thuth@redhat.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20200921174320.46062-1-thuth@redhat.com>
We're not supporting Debian 9 anymore, and we are now testing
MinGW cross-compiler builds in the gitlab-CI, too, so we do not
really need these jobs in the shippable.yml anymore.
Signed-off-by: Thomas Huth <thuth@redhat.com>
---
.shippable.yml | 4 ----
1 file changed, 4 deletions(-)
diff --git a/.shippable.yml b/.shippable.yml
index 0b4fd6df1d..14350e6de8 100644
--- a/.shippable.yml
+++ b/.shippable.yml
@@ -7,10 +7,6 @@ env:
matrix:
- IMAGE=debian-amd64
TARGET_LIST=x86_64-softmmu,x86_64-linux-user
- - IMAGE=debian-win32-cross
- TARGET_LIST=arm-softmmu,i386-softmmu
- - IMAGE=debian-win64-cross
- TARGET_LIST=aarch64-softmmu,sparc64-softmmu,x86_64-softmmu
- IMAGE=debian-armel-cross
TARGET_LIST=arm-softmmu,arm-linux-user,armeb-linux-user
- IMAGE=debian-armhf-cross
